2016 Buffalo Bills training camp schedule
![]() |
| credit: freedigitalphotos.net/John Kasawa |
The Buffalo Bills will open their 2016 training camp
schedule on Saturday, July 30 at St. John Fisher College in Pittsford.
There will be five night practices, which will require free
tickets. In all, there will be 16 practices open to the public, beginning July
30 and closing Monday, August 22.
2016 Buffalo Bills
Training Camp Schedule:
- Saturday, July 30 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Sunday, July 31 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Monday, August 1 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Tuesday, August 2 – 6-8 p.m. (ticket required)
- Thursday, August 4 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Friday, August 5 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Saturday, August 6 – 6:30-8:30 p.m. (ticket required)
- Monday, August 8 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Tuesday, August 9 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Wednesday, August 10 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Thursday, August 11 – 6-8 p.m. (ticket required)
- Monday, August 15 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Tuesday, August 16 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Wednesday, August 17 – 10 a.m.-noon
- Thursday, August 18 – 6-8 p.m. (ticket required)
- Monday, August 22 – 6-8 p.m. (ticket required)

2015 Buffalo Bills training camp schedule
![]() |
| credit: freedigitalphotos.net/John Kasawa |
The Buffalo Bills open their 2015 training camp on Friday, July 31st at St. John Fisher College in
Pittsford. There are five night practices, which will require free tickets,
as well as one ticketed daytime practice. There will be a total of 17 practices
open to the public through Tuesday, August 25th.
2015 Buffalo Bills
Training Camp Schedule:
- Friday, July 31 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Saturday, August 1 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Sunday, August 2 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Monday, August 3 – 6 to 8 p.m. (ticket required)
- Wednesday, August 5 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Thursday, August 6 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Friday, August 7 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Saturday, August 8 – 7 to 8:30 p.m. (ticket required)
- Monday, August 10 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Tuesday, August 11 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Wednesday, August 12 – 6 to 8 p.m. (ticket required)
- Sunday, August 16 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Monday, August 17 – 10 a.m. to noon (ticket required) – joint practice with the Cleveland Browns
- Tuesday, August 18 – 6 to 8 p.m. (ticket required) – joint practice with the Cleveland Browns
- Saturday, August 22 – 10 a.m. to noon
- Sunday, August 23 – 6 to 8 p.m. (ticket required)
- Tuesday, August 25 – 10 a.m. to noon

Reinvention…Buffalo Sports Style
Once again, Buffalo and its surrounding suburbs – and ex-pats
around the country and the world, for that matter – are basking in the glow of
Pegula-mania. Terry and Kim Pegula , owners of the Sabres for a few years now,
now own the Bills as well, and in essence become the most powerful couple in
Buffalo.
![]() |
| credit: bills-backers.com/97Rock.com |
This is not a bad thing.
The Pegulas, the Sabres and the Bills are all a vital part
of the reinvention of Buffalo: the city is changing, growing, rebuilding – and so
are our sports teams. Reinvention, growth, change, constructions – they all
come with some growing pains, and it can take what seems like a long time, but
it can all be worth it in the end.
The Pegulas share a vision with many of us for Buffalo, and
they have shown their love for the Queen City by creating: jobs, revenue,
places to go and things to do. They are also the epitome of the Buffalo dream:
start small, work hard, become successful. They’ve become successful enough that
they’re now trying to help our area recognize a couple of other dreams:
championships for out hockey and football teams.
In Buffalo, we’re used to rough rides, be it in sports, the
weather or the economy. But we get through it, and we’re stronger for it. Some people
refer to Buffalo as a drinking town with a sports problem – if that’s the case,
raise your glass to the Pegulas, sit back, strap in and enjoy the bumpy ride.
